Understanding Outplacement Services Pricing

outplacement services pricing can vary widely depending on the provider, the level of service required, and the specific needs of the individual or organization seeking assistance. Outplacement services are designed to help employees who have been laid off or are transitioning to a new job find new employment opportunities. These services can include resume writing, career counseling, job search assistance, and more. In this article, we will explore the factors that influence outplacement services pricing and how to determine the best value for your investment.

One of the key factors that can impact outplacement services pricing is the level of service that is required. Some outplacement firms offer comprehensive packages that include personalized career coaching, resume and cover letter writing, job search assistance, and networking opportunities. These full-service packages tend to be more expensive but can provide valuable support to individuals who are looking to make a successful career transition.

On the other hand, some outplacement firms offer a more basic level of service that may include resume templates, access to job boards, and group coaching sessions. These services are typically more affordable but may not provide the same level of personalized support as a full-service package. It is important to evaluate your needs and budget to determine the level of service that is right for you or your organization.

Another factor that can influence outplacement services pricing is the duration of the services. Some outplacement firms charge a one-time fee for a set period of time, while others may charge a monthly or hourly rate for ongoing support. The duration of the services can impact the overall cost, so it is important to clarify how long you will need assistance and what payment structure works best for your budget.

Additionally, the reputation and experience of the outplacement firm can also impact pricing. Established firms with a strong track record of success may charge higher prices for their services, while newer or less experienced firms may offer more competitive rates. It is important to research different outplacement providers, read customer reviews, and ask for references to determine which firm offers the best value for your investment.

When comparing outplacement services pricing, it is also important to consider the specific needs of the individual or organization seeking assistance. Some employees may require more intensive support, such as career counseling or interview coaching, while others may only need help updating their resume and navigating the job market. By understanding your specific needs, you can choose an outplacement firm that offers the services you need at a price that fits your budget.

In addition to pricing, it is also important to consider the quality of the services offered by the outplacement firm. Look for providers that have a strong reputation for helping clients find new job opportunities, provide personalized support, and offer ongoing guidance throughout the job search process. It is also helpful to ask about success rates, job placement outcomes, and client satisfaction to ensure that you are choosing a reputable firm that will help you achieve your career goals.

Ultimately, outplacement services pricing is influenced by a variety of factors, including the level of service required, the duration of the services, the reputation of the firm, and the specific needs of the individual or organization seeking assistance.
